FINISHING OF KNITTED GOODS



   FINISHING OF KNITTED GOODS



Knitted goods are commonly used for undergarments, sports year and to a limited extent as casual wear One peculiar quality of knitted goods are that it can be easily deformed and will lose its shape when stretched For these fabrics which are meant to be used as undergarments and sports wears, the main requirement is that the material should be absorbent so that sweat can be assorted easily.

One of the most common finishing is to apply a softening agent to the fabric. Care should be taken in such a way that the given finish will not destroy the Porous Nature of the fabric

     SOFTENING OF KNITTED GOODS


To soften the knitted goods, softening is done by using softeners As and if is in the tubular form, normally Exhaust method is applied using Winch. Care should be taken that the machine which is used for this purpose is tensionless  there is tension, the elastic beauty of the knitted good will be spoiled.
Softeners like Anionic, Non-ionic, Cationic and Reactive softeners may be used. Reactive softeners produce Permanent softness Other softeners will produce Temporary softness. Silicone emulsion is also used as a softening agent for knitted goods

      DIMENSIONAL CONTROL OF KNITTED  GOODS



The objective of calendaring is to) To make the knitted goods more lustrous. 2) To impart smoothness 3) To impart Full Handle. 4) To impart Dimensional Stability Calendering 2nd Dimensional control of knitted is done using Santex. goods It is a combined Calendar and Compacting machine

The machine consists of the following features Fabric feeding de-ice. Steaming box Compacting and pressing device. Precision plaiter. The knitted goods are passed into the first steamer through the feeding device. In the steaming process, the goods are obtained in a more pliable nature. Then it is passed through a Pressing device to get Dimensional control. Here, heat and pressure are applied with stretching Finally it is plaited on the platter table and kept for some time and finally, it is dried. Felt Calendar ma ha ca also be used for this calendering purpose ie no tension on the fabric.
